Love Dance
1976 studio album by Woody Shaw
From Wikipedia, the free encyclopedia
Love Dance is the fourth album led by trumpeter Woody Shaw which was recorded in 1975 and released on the Muse label.[1][2] Love Dance was reissued by Mosaic Records as part of Woody Shaw: The Complete Muse Sessions in 2013.

Track listing
All compositions by Woody Shaw except as indicated
- "Love Dance" (Joe Bonner) - 12:37
- "Obsequious" (Larry Young) - 9:28
- "Sunbath" (Peggy Stern) - 6:33
- "Zoltan" - 6:48
- "Soulfully I Love You (Black Spiritual of Love)" (Billy Harper) - 8:13
